Antonio Orlando, mafia boss and one of most dangerous fugitives in Italy, was captured by police after discovering his luxury hideout near Naples. Orlando is suspected of participating in the Camorra organized crime group. He has spent the last fifteen years on the run, during which time he never stopped giving orders to the rest of the group, according to police.“The good times are over for the 60-year old mobster,” Interior Minister Matteo Salvini said.Agents discovered the suspect in a flat in Mugnano with luxury items such as a treadmill, a sauna, and sun shower tanning machine. It was even equipped with a secret hideaway. Orlando, who had been preparing to move to another hideout when the raid occurred, was in the process of destroying fake identity documents and “raised his hands in a sign of surrender.”The bust uncovered the equivalent of $6,794 in cash along with messages he had been sending to the group, which is well-known for trafficking drugs from Morocco and Spain, as well as money laundering, extortion, and murder. The Orlando family has strong ties by marriage with the Nuvoletta clan. Police were helped by a hitman-turned-informant.
